I'd go 500 for a fuel injected 360 magnum with 100k miles or less most of them have very little bore wear, because fuel injection system I'm told doesn't wash the cylinders down. The last one I bought was in really nice shape with the cross hatches still in the cylinders. Plus the cost for machine shop work around here is ridiculous. That machine shop here wanted $700 to hot tank the block and heads.

The 100,000 mile Magnums are usually golden. The stock cams can easily be reground to something fun. Slap on a set of Speedmaster heads (or Edelbrock) and rock and roll!
 

I just sold a complete, running TBI 360 from a 90 Ram Charger with all the gingerbread still attached, alt., A/C compressor, P/S pump etc. for $400 a few weeks ago to a member here.
